Warrenville is a city in DuPage County, Illinois, United States. The population was 13,553 at the 2020 census. [ 3 ] Warrenville is a far west suburb of Chicago on the DuPage River .
The Erich Fromm Prize (German: Erich-Fromm-Preis) is a German prize bestowed upon people who have advanced Humanism through their scientific, social, sociopolitical or journalistic engagement. The prize is named after Erich Fromm , a Jewish German-American philosopher, psychoanalyst and psychologist. [ 1 ]
Wayne Fromm is a Canadian inventor and entrepreneur who is most notable for being the original patent holder of the selfie stick for digital cameras and cell phones. Branded as the Quik Pod , it is a handheld extendable stick for digital cameras and smart phones for taking pictures of one's self.
Two Brothers Brewing Company is an independently owned Illinois-based microbrewery founded by brothers Jim and Jason Ebel in 1996. The brothers brought their knowledge of different brewing styles to the Chicago craft brew market after living in Europe and experiencing the variety of beers available there.
Friedrich Wilhelm Waldemar Fromm (8 October 1888 – 12 March 1945) was a German Army officer. In World War II , Fromm was Commander in Chief of the Replacement Army ( Ersatzheer ), in charge of training and personnel replacement for combat divisions of the German Army , a position he occupied for most of the war. Community Unit School District 200 (CUSD 200) based in Wheaton, Illinois is a public unit school district mainly serving the communities of Wheaton and Warrenville.CUSD 200 also services portions of Carol Stream, Winfield, and West Chicago, as well as adjacent unincorporated areas within DuPage County.
Paul Fromm (September 28, 1906 – July 4, 1987) was a Jewish Chicago wine merchant and performing arts patron through the Fromm Music Foundation. [1] The Organum for Paul Fromm was composed by John Harbison in his honor.
